Highguard, the free-to-play hero shooter from Wildlight Entertainment, will shut down permanently on March 12, 2026, less than two months after its January 26 launch.
Despite peaking at nearly 100,000 concurrent players and attracting over two million initial users, the game failed to sustain a long-term player base.
Wildlight cited an inability to build a financially viable community, citing declining activity, mixed reviews, and the loss of investor funding.
A final update will release before shutdown, adding a new Warden, weapon, account progression, and skill trees.
Servers will remain online until March 12, giving players a final chance to play.
